First, what should I do if I have coccyx pain after cesarean section? What should I do if I have coccyx pain after delivery? To treat coccyx pain after delivery, the cause must be found out. So far, the treatment of coccyx pain is generally divided into conservative treatment and surgical treatment. Conservative treatment of coccyx pain may take several weeks or even several months. If there is no improvement after long-term conservative treatment,

When the coccyx joint is significantly unstable or loose, the coccyx can be surgically removed. It will take about four to eight months for symptoms to improve after surgery.

What should I do if I have pain in my buttocks and coccyx after a cesarean section? Postpartum coccyx pain may be caused by damage to the pelvic floor muscles and coccyx when the fetus passes through the pelvic cavity during delivery. You can rest in bed. If the pain is relieved, it means the treatment is effective. If invalid, further inspection is required. This pain is more common in women with large fetuses, small pelvises and prolonged labor. It is mainly caused by displacement of the coccyx, inflammation of the periosteum or nerve compression. It may also be caused by compression of the coccyx by the presenting part of the fetus. At the beginning, you can take painkillers and rest more, and then do some recovery exercises later. Generally, recovery takes a few weeks.
